signing

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. The act of concluding a contract, especially by an athlete or entertainer with a company.
  2. A player signed by a sporting organization.
  3. An event held in a bookshop etc. where copies of a book are signed by the author.
  4. The use of sign language; skill at using a sign language.
verb
  1. present participle and gerund of sign
